Permanent abatement options include... - Paint removal, component removal, enclosure, encapsulation 
Lead Inspector - A certified individual who conducts a surface-by-surface investigation 
 to determine the presence of lead-based paint. 
Lead-based paint - 1 mg/cm2 
5000micrograms/g = 5000ppm 
.5% by weight
